crankshaft seal keeps breaking on 2004 Hyundai Elantra

front crankshaft seal blew out of nowhere. they put a new one in and that one blew immediately. what could be causing this?

Customer Concern: Front crank seal repeat failures, pushing out.
Tests/Procedures: 1. Check crank case pressure (blow by) at wide open throttle.

2. Check and clean the drain hole in the oil pump housing at about the 6 o'clock position just behind the seal.
Potential Causes: Excessive Blow-By
Restricted Seal Drain

1 more answer
Excellent information autoknowhow! I'm assuming this is a technical service bulletin? Can you please post the TSB# if it is indeed a bulletin? thanks!